| 505 ## - FORMATTED CONTENTS NOTE | |
| Formatted contents note | Table of Contents:<br/>Part I: The Nature of Human Capital;<br/>1:An Economic Perspective on the Notion of Human Capital, Margaret M. Blair;<br/>2:A Social Perspective: Exploring the Links between Human Capital and Social Capital, Janine Nahapiet;<br/>3:Culture Capital and Cosmopolitan Human Capital: the Impact of the Global Mindset and Organizational Routines on Cultural Intelligence and International Experiences, Kok-Yee Ng, Mei Ling Tan and Soon Ang;<br/>4:Cognition and Human Capital: The Dynamic Interrelationship between Knowledge and Behaviour, Rhett Brymer, Michael A. Hitt, and Mario Schijven;<br/>5:Critical Perspective: Reflections on the Nature and Scope of the Concept of Capital and its Extension to Intangibles - a Capital-Based Approach to the Firm, Peter Lewin;<br/>Part II: Human Capital and the Firm;<br/>6:Human Capital and Transaction Cost Economics, Nicolai J. Foss;<br/>7:Human Capital and Agency Theory, J.-C. Spender;<br/>8:Human Capital in the Resource-based View, Jeroen Kraaijenbrink;<br/>9:Human Capital, Entrepreneurship and the Theory of the Firm, Brian J. Loasby;<br/>10:Human Capital and the Knowledge-based Theory of the Firm, Georg von Krogh, and Martin W. Wallin;<br/>Part III: Human Capital and Organizational Effectiveness;<br/>11:Human Capital, HR Strategy and Organizational Effectiveness, Peter Boxall;<br/>12:How Organizations obtain the Human Capital they need, Monika Hamori, Rocio Bonet, and Peter Cappelli;<br/>13:Aligning Human Capital with Organizational Needs, David Lepak, Riki Takeuchi, and Juani Swart;<br/>14:Maximizing Value from Human Capital, Russell Coff;<br/>15:Accounting for Human Capital and Organizational Effectiveness, Robin Kramar, Vijaya Murthy and James Guthrie;<br/>Part IV: Human Capital Interdependencies;<br/>16:Interdependencies between People in Organizations, Robert M. Grant and James C. Hayton;<br/>17:Interdependencies between Human and Structural Capital, David O'Donnell;<br/>18:The Distributed and Dynamic Dimensions of Human Capital, Ikujiro Nonaka, Ryoko Toyoma, and Vesa Peltokorpi;<br/>19:Human Capital and the Organization-Accommodation Relationship, Jacqueline C. Vischer;<br/>20:Interdependencies between People and Information Systems in Organizations, Alan Burton-Jones and Andrew Burton-Jones<br/>Part V: Human Capital in the Future Economy;<br/>21:Human Capital, Capabilities and the Firm: Literati, Numerati, and Entrepreneurs in the 21st Century Enterprise, David J. Teece;<br/>22:Looking to the Future: Bringing Organizations Deeper into Human Capital Theory, Peter D. Sherer;<br/>23:Human Capital Formation Regimes: States, Markets and Human Capital in an Era of Globalisation, Sean Ó Riain;<br/>24:Supporting Human Capital in Developing Countries: The Significance of the Asian Experience, Thomas Clarke;<br/>25:The Future of Human Capital: An Employment Relations Perspective, Thomas A. Kochan and Adam Seth Litwin. |
